Understanding WhatsApp's Features

Free Text Messaging

WhatsApp allows you to send unlimited text messages to other WhatsApp users worldwide without incurring any charges. This includes group chats with up to 256 participants.

Voice and Video Calling

Make high-quality voice and video calls to other WhatsApp users, regardless of their location or device. These calls are encrypted end-to-end, ensuring privacy and security.

File Sharing

Send and receive files of various types, including images, videos, documents, and even GIFs. WhatsApp supports file sizes of up to 100 MB for documents and 16 MB for media.

Status Updates

Share updates about your day with your contacts through short text, photo, or video statuses. These updates expire after 24 hours.

End-to-End Encryption

WhatsApp uses end-to-end encryption to protect all communications on its platform. This means that your messages, calls, and file transfers are private between you and the intended recipient(s).

How to Set Up WhatsApp for Free

  1. Download the App: Search for "WhatsApp" in your app store and download the official app.
  2. Register Your Account: Enter your phone number and verify it with the code sent via SMS or voice call.
  3. Create a Profile: Add a profile picture, name, and optional status.

Pros and Cons of WhatsApp

Pros:

  • Free: Unlimited texting, voice calls, and video calls.
  • Cross-Platform: Available on multiple devices, including iOS, Android, and Windows.
  • Privacy Focused: End-to-end encryption protects your communications.
  • File Sharing: Send and receive various file types with ease.
  • Worldwide Reach: Connect with people from around the globe.

Cons:

  • Data Usage: Excessive WhatsApp usage can increase mobile data consumption.
  • File Size Limits: Restrictions on the size of media and document files that can be shared.
  • Potential for Spam: Users may receive unsolicited messages from unknown senders.
  • Battery Drain: WhatsApp's continuous background activity can drain your device's battery.

Additional Tips for Cost-Effective WhatsApp Usage

  • Use WiFi whenever possible to avoid data charges.
  • Compress images and videos before sending them to reduce file size.
  • Disable automatic downloads for media in WhatsApp settings.
  • Turn off location sharing when not necessary to conserve battery.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Is WhatsApp truly free to use?

Yes, WhatsApp offers free text messaging, voice calls, video calls, and group chats without any subscription fees.

2. How do I prevent my contacts from seeing my last seen time?

Go to "Settings" > "Account" > "Privacy" and choose "Nobody" under "Last Seen."

3. Can I use WhatsApp on a computer?

Yes, you can access WhatsApp on your computer using the WhatsApp Web or Desktop applications.

4. What are the file size limits for media and documents in WhatsApp?

The maximum file size for media (images, videos, and GIFs) is 16 MB, and for documents, it's 100 MB.

5. How do I block someone on WhatsApp?

Go to the chat of the contact you wish to block and tap "Block" in the contact options.

6. Can I recover deleted WhatsApp messages?

Deleted WhatsApp messages cannot be recovered natively within the app. However, you can restore deleted messages from a backup if it has been created and enabled prior to the deletion.

7. How do I report a problematic contact?

Go to the chat of the contact you wish to report and tap "Report Contact" in the contact options.

8. What is the best way to use WhatsApp for business?

Create a WhatsApp Business account to manage business inquiries, customer support, and marketing campaigns effectively.
